THE WOI WURRUNG NURSERY RHYME SERIES presents well loved nursery rhymes in English — and translated into the ancient Woi wurrung language of the Wurundjeri people. Yingora Yingora Wayibu Durt — TWINKLE TWINKLE LITTLE STAR is translated by Wurundjeri elder, Aunty Gail Smith, with Lily Mammone’s illustrations.

The Watery Tale of Bucket the Naughty Duckling is an imaginative story that explores the secret lives of native waterfowl. The story was inspired by the daily antics of the birdlife of Horseshoe Lagoon in Casino, New South Wales, where Gwendolyn has lived for the past 35 years.
